Egypt, New Kingdom to Third Intermediate Period, 18th to 24th Dynasty, ca. 1549 to 653 BCE. A wonderful faience ushabti enveloped in brilliant azure-hued glaze with wig, eyes, implements, and an inscription delineated in darker, ultramarine pigment. The verso is left unglazed, save for black-painted hair and a bag of grain whose central placement is indicative of the New Kingdom to Third Intermediate period. Travelling centrally down the mummiform body, the inscription may translate to Tefnakht, the prince of Sais and first king of the 24th Dynasty. The ancient Egyptians believed that after they died, their spirits would have to work in the "Field of Reeds" owned by the god of the underworld, Osiris. As a result, ushabtis are frequently depicted with arms crossed, holding picks and hoes, with baskets on their backs. This meant that the task of agricultural labor was required by all members of society, from workers to pharaohs. The brilliant blue of this ushabti is associated with the sky and the Nile, and thus represents the universe, creation, and fertility. Size: 1" W x 3.6" H (2.5 cm x 9.1 cm)
